Even though there are many ways to use rainwater in the home, this valuable resource literally goes down the drain far too often. This leads to many problems. With growth of impervious surface in our cities, flooding is becoming more prevalent. This increased runoff, means water does not have a chance to evaporate, leading to what is called the heat island effect. The higher amount of impervious surfaces also lead to groundwater supplied not being replenished. More and more as water demand is increasing, groundwater and reservoir supplies are being depleted. You can make an enormous contribution to reducing these problems by using a rainwater system.

Two-shell plastic storage tank

The INTEWA two-shell tankhelps address all of these issues.  The novel tank, consisting of two halves are easily assembled on site, offers you two possible uses: as a 2 m³ (528 gallon) rainwater cistern or infiltration tank, both with a vehicle rating.  These elements are made of 100% polypropylene recycled plastic using the latest injection moulding technology. The highly efficient product significantly reduces production, transport, and storage costs compared to one-piece storage tanks, which gives it a clear financial advantage.

Regardless of how large your rainwater system will be, this practical design means that everything can be delivered on a single pallet beacuse the two piece “clam shel” design allows for stacking which takes up a lot less space!

The two halves are easily attached on site and are completely waterproof.

 

 

Independently cool the environment by evaporation of rainwater

With your rainwater system, you can make an important contribution to minimizing global warming. In addition, you can green and cool your garden cost-effectively. With an  evaporation of only 20 m³ you cool with 20 x 690 kWh/m³ = 18,800 kWh. This corresponds approximately to the total annual energy consumption of an older single-family home.

 

How the two-shell rainwater tank pays off

Rainwater harvesting in the garden

A typical single-family home with a roof area of 100 m³ (1100 square feet) can collect up to 80 m³ per year in Germany (21,000 gallons) and much more in other geographies. Assuming that you only collect 20 m³ (5300 gallons) and use it for garden irrigation, you will save an average of 5.00 €/m³ in municipal water and sewer costs; that is, a tidy 100.00 €/year. With investment costs of approx. 500.00 €, your system will have paid for itself after only 5 years.

Stormwater Infiltration

In order to infiltrate captured stormwater into the ground holes are drilled in the tank.

With the introduction of the so-called "fee splitting", your sealed area is often taxed with more than 1,00 € /m² in many areas. You avoid this by installing your own infiltration tank. If you combine the infiltration with your rainwater storage tank, you also save on pre-filtration. With a roof area of 150 and 1,00 €/ m² sealing fee you save 150,00 €/ year.  A typical system pays for itself in less than 4 years.

One tank - many applications

Since the finished tanks are low profile with an overall height of 1.2 m, the excvation required for installation is not as difficult as with other tanks. In fact heavy excavation equipment is not needed. It is possible to install the system as a retrofit on existing drainage lines because the PLURAFIT pre-filter does not have a height offset. The filters and manways have extenstions to any burial depth. In this way, the system is individually adapted to your site conditions. While the omost common systems are for garden watering and infiltration, many other applications are possible. The tank also serves as a attenuation cistern; it is ideal for rainwater harvesting for indoor use and can even be used as a greywater storage tank. The underground, frost-proof storage keeps the water cool and algae-free.
